With contemporary styling and cutting-edge technology, the Zero Turn 10 is the perfect combination of aggressive performance and maneuverability. Powerful dual motors and two-wheel drive offers aggressive traction, easily tackling rugged terrain on trails. When you’re done spending time outdoors, the Zero Turn 10 transitions seamlessly indoors. Maneuver smoothly through the halls and doorways with iTurn Technology™.
Three-speed control lets you adjust your speed when moving from indoor to outdoor driving
iTurn Technology™ provides 4-wheel stability with 3-wheel maneuverability
Advanced suspension for improved absorption over rough surfaces
Stylish, sleek lighting gives you form and function in low-lit areas
Automatically adjusts brightness to suit your environment
Weight Capacity | 400 lbs. |
Maximum Speed1 | Up to 7 mph |
Ground Clearance3 | 2" at motor |
Turning Radius3 | 43" |
Overall Length3 | 48" |
Overall Width3 | 24.25" |
Seat-to-Ground Height | 22.25"-24.25" |
Seat-to-Deck Height | 15.5"-17.5" |
Front Tires | 9" solid |
Rear Tires | 10.75" solid |
Suspension | Front and rear (CTS Suspension) |
Range Per Charge 1,2 | Up to 18 miles at 400 lbs. Up to 24 miles at 200 lbs. |
Total Weight Without Batteries5 | 197.6 lbs. |
Heaviest Piece When Disassembled3 | 75 lbs. (front section) |
Standard Seating3 | Type: Reclining High Back Weight: 45.8 lbs. Material: Black Vinyl Dimensions: Width: 20" Depth: 20" |
Drive System | 24-volt DC motor, rear-wheel drive, dual in-line |
Dual Braking System | Regenerative and electromechanical |
Battery Requirements4,6 | Size: (2) 40 Ah Weight: 30.25 lbs. each |
Battery Charger | Off-board, 3.5 amp |
Warranty | Frame: lifetime limited Drivetrain: 2-year limited Electronics: 2-year limited Battery: 6-months |
Your Pride product has undergone thorough product testing to ensure safety, durability and performance.
Pride Mobility Products Canada is a licensed distributor with Health Canada and the medical device products offered meet or exceed specific Provinces’ requirements/testing prior to release for public use.
The testing requirements were developed by the American National Standards Institute/Rehabilitation Engineering & Assistive Technology Society of North America (ANSI/RESNA).
Our medical power chairs, scooters and lift chairs are also approved by the U.S. Food & Drug Administration (FDA) as medical products that require specific testing prior to release for public use.
The tests are conducted in accordance with the requirements of the ANSI/RESNA Test Standards and complement an additional stringent testing regiment developed by Pride's Research & Development Team.
All products have passed, and in many cases, exceeded test criteria set forth, assuring the high level of quality synonymous with Pride.
